#416748 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#416748 is composed of 25.5% red, 40.4%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 36.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 30.1% yellow and 59.6% black. It has a hue angle of 131.1 degrees, a saturation of 22.6% and a lightness of 32.9%. #416748 color hex could be obtained by blending #82ce90 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#416748 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#416748 has RGB values of R:65, G:103, B:72 and CMYK values of C:0.37, M:0, Y:0.3, K:0.6. Its decimal value is 4286280.
